## Step 4: Configure the Sweeper

The Grimsby retention sweeper runs nightly and deletes records past their hold window. Copy `sweeper.env.sample` to `sweeper.env` in the deploy directory. Set `GRIMSBY_RETENTION_DAYS` per the data policy sheet (default 90), `GRIMSBY_DRY_RUN=false` once you've verified output in staging, and `GRIMSBY_BATCH_SIZE=500`. The sweeper must authenticate to the archive store before it can purge anything, so add the archive access token as the final line of the file.

secret setting of tahog-kahap: COURIER_KEY8=1c6aac8a

## GraphWeave Plugin Runbook — Render Hooks

External plugins that extend the GraphWeave dependency visualizer must register a render hook before calling the layout engine. Hooks run after node resolution but before edge bundling, so avoid mutating the graph model directly. To fetch resolved manifests, your plugin must authenticate against the internal Manifold resolver service on each cold start. Use the shared plugin credential below for all resolver requests.

service key, kaduf-bawig: kto15_Ze79S0dligTw0yO

## Tuning

This change migrates WageLoom's payroll export from fixed-width to delimited records for the Ostern Mills rollout. Batch sizing and rounding behavior are now configurable rather than hardcoded, since downstream systems disagreed on both. Reviewer note: only the constants changed semantics; the writer logic is untouched. The new defaults are shown below.

tuning table, taguf-kaduf:
TIERS = {
    "drudor": 562,
    "ulaael": 30,
    "brieth": 879,
}

# Break-Glass: Catalog Cache Invalidation

Scope: the Pinrow product catalog at Veldstone Retail. If stale prices persist after a purge and the Hollowmere invalidation queue is wedged, use break-glass to flush the edge tier directly. Contractors: get verbal sign-off from the catalog lead first. Steps: open the Hollowmere admin shell, select emergency-flush, confirm the tenant, and run it once — repeated flushes thrash the origin. Access is logged and expires after 20 minutes. Unseal the admin shell with the passphrase below.

recovery phrase for kahop-tajog: istix-casvan